The day of the trial in the wilderness. {Hebrews 3:8}
Let no man say when he is tempted, "I am tempted by God," for God can't be tempted by evil, and he himself tempts no one. But each one is tempted, when he is drawn away by his own lust, and enticed. Then the lust, when it has conceived, bears sin. {James 1:13-15}
They gave in to craving in the desert, and tested God in the wasteland. {Psalms 106:14}
Jesus, full of the Holy Spirit, returned from the Jordan, and was led by the Spirit into the wilderness for forty days, being tempted by the devil. He ate nothing in those days. Afterward, when they were completed, he was hungry. The devil said to him, "If you are the Son of God, command this stone to become bread." {Luke 4:1-3}
He himself has suffered being tempted, he is able to help those who are tempted. {Hebrews 2:18} "Simon, Simon, behold, Satan asked to have you, that he might sift you as wheat, but I prayed for you, that your faith wouldn't fail." {Luke 22:31,32}
